Objective-c是在c語(yǔ)言基礎(chǔ)上做了面向?qū)ο髷U(kuò)展,與gobject相似。Oc(Objective-c)與Cocoa和Cocoa touch框架高度繼承,支持開(kāi)發(fā)...
IP屬地:青海
Objective-c是在c語(yǔ)言基礎(chǔ)上做了面向?qū)ο髷U(kuò)展,與gobject相似。Oc(Objective-c)與Cocoa和Cocoa touch框架高度繼承,支持開(kāi)發(fā)...
Oc作為面向?qū)ο笳Z(yǔ)言,即含有類型系統(tǒng),主要包括引用類型和值類型 引用類型主要有:類,指針,塊 值類型主要有:基礎(chǔ)數(shù)值類型,結(jié)構(gòu),枚舉 類與結(jié)構(gòu)的區(qū)別:類是引用類型:位于棧上的...
數(shù)據(jù)成員:實(shí)例變量,屬性。 屬性表達(dá)實(shí)例的狀態(tài),描述類型對(duì)外的結(jié)構(gòu),屬性可以做很多控制。 在默認(rèn)情況下,編譯器會(huì)為屬性定義propertyName自動(dòng)合成getter訪問(wèn)器方...
函數(shù)是代碼段上的可執(zhí)行指令序列:全局函數(shù),成員函數(shù)。 方法是類的成員函數(shù),表達(dá)實(shí)例的行為或者類型行為,所有方法都默認(rèn)為公有方法,沒(méi)有私有方法或protected方法,在對(duì)象上...
初始化器: 初始化器主要用于初始化對(duì)象實(shí)例或者類型,是一個(gè)特殊的函數(shù)。 對(duì)象初始化器:-(id)init可以重載多個(gè) 類型初始化器:+(void)initialize只能有一...
Oc作為c擴(kuò)展的面向?qū)ο笳Z(yǔ)言,具有面向?qū)ο笳Z(yǔ)言的三大基本特性:封裝,繼承,多態(tài) 繼承是指每一個(gè)類只能有一個(gè)基類,子類自動(dòng)繼承基類的實(shí)例變量,屬性,實(shí)例方法,類方法 所有根類是...